How long does breakfast sausage last in the fridge?

Breakfast sausage is a popular choice for morning meals, and knowing how long it lasts in the fridge is essential for food safety and freshness. Typically, cooked breakfast sausage can last up to 3 to 4 days in the fridge. Raw breakfast sausage, however, is best consumed within 1 to 2 days.

To ensure maximum freshness, always store breakfast sausage in an airtight container. Keep the fridge temperature at or below 40°F to slow down bacterial growth. If you’re unsure whether your sausage is still good, check for any off smells or discoloration before consuming.


Here’s a comprehensive guide on how long different types of breakfast sausage last in the fridge:

  • Uncooked breakfast sausage: 1-2 days
  • Cooked breakfast sausage: 3-4 days
  • Vacuum-sealed breakfast sausage: 1-2 weeks (until opened)

Signs Your Breakfast Sausage Has Spoiled

Always be cautious with food safety. Check for these signs that may indicate your breakfast sausage has gone bad:

  • Off smell: A sour or unusual odor indicates spoilage.
  • Discoloration: Any grayish color is a warning sign.
  • Texture changes: Slimy or sticky texture can mean the sausage has gone bad.

How to Store Breakfast Sausage Properly

To extend the shelf life of your breakfast sausage, follow these storage tips:

  • Refrigeration: Store in an airtight container to minimize exposure to air and moisture.
  • Freezing: If you can’t consume it quickly, freeze the sausage. This can extend its lifespan to about 4 months.
  • Labeling: Always label your containers with the date they were cooked or purchased.

Can You Reheat Cooked Breakfast Sausage?

Yes, you can safely reheat cooked breakfast sausage. Make sure to heat it until it’s steaming hot, reaching an internal temperature of 165°F before eating.
